What's Happening?
Director Justine Triet, known for her Oscar and Palme d’Or-winning film 'Anatomy of a Fall', is set to begin production on her first full English-language feature, 'Fonda'. The psychological thriller will star Odessa A'zion, Ewan Mitchell, Cherry Jones,
and Benedict Wong. The film is co-produced by Delphine Tomson’s Les Films du Fleuve and backed by House Productions and BBC Film. Scheduled to shoot from April to June, 'Fonda' is described as a psychological thriller set in a seemingly idyllic environment, exploring themes of grief and obsession. The project reunites Triet with producers Marie-Ange Luciani and David Thion, and sales agent MK2 Films. The film will be distributed by Studiocanal in several territories, including France, Germany, and Australia.
